Question by bjmarchini: “business” projector versus home theater DLP projector for movies, games and an htpc?
I am going to get a front end projector. I am nearly decided that I need a “home theater” projector as opposed to a standard “business” projector.

At first, I dismissed the home theater ones because of their much lower lumens compared to their business counterparts. Of course, the business ones tend to be much cheaper though.

These are the drawbacks of a business projector from what I have research

o white spaces in color wheel to increase lumens makes it too bright
o poor handling of motion in video
o less inputs for multiple devices
o generally not 16:9 native so you have to deal with gray bars
o poor handling of black levels

I wonder how real these issues or concerns are and if anyone uses a business one for their home theater.

I will be using it with our dvd player, home theater pc and an nintendo Wii.

Best answer:

Answer by weeder
I saw your previous questions and saw the poster commenting on the Epson not being any good because it’s a “business” projector. I can tell you from experience that there is absolutely nothing wrong with the S4 as a movie pj since it was the first one I owned and looked spectacular. I even used it outside on my outdoor 24′ theater and it was plenty bright enough to throw the 45′ required to get the larger image.

In my opinion as long as you get a good brand pj with decent lumens, contrast ratio and resolution you won’t be disappointed and forget all this business vs movie pj nonsense. I’ve never found a “business” pj that did not perform as well as a “movie” pj assuming the specs are good.

Question by bunny: What is a good “work from home business” ?

I am a college graduate in child care. I live in central Kentucky.
I do not want to babysit do to getting sued do to whatever happens.

Best answer:

Answer by Brother Otter
Both of the answers you have so far promote CashCrate – an outfit that purports to pay you for sitting on your backside and sampling products. What they don’t tell you is that you end up spending money…

The same rules apply to “work at home” as everywhere else: you have to create something of value that someone else wants and is willing to pay for. The more education you have, the higher the price you can command.
The options start with piecework and hand fabrication where you’ll be making a few dollars an hour, and go up to medical transcription work and telemarketing. I’m not aware that you can do customer service support from at-home, but it might be worth asking.

The information you’ve completely left out is: What education/training do you have, what CAN you do, and what region do you live in? Those more than anything determine where you go looking.
